THOMASTON — Mr. William Floyd Morgan , 83 of Thomaston, died Friday, February 22, 2013 at his residence. Funeral services were held on Monday, February 25, at 11 a.m. in the Pasley-Fletcher Funeral Home Chapel. Burial followed in Upson Memorial Gardens. Rev. Donnie Morgan and Rev. Joey Smith officiated.

Mr. Morgan was born in Manchester, Meriwether County, Georgia to the late Willie Frank Morgan and the late Minnie Bell Thompson Morgan. He served in the United States Army during the Korean Conflict. He was a lifelong basketball, football, baseball coach and was Assistant Scoutmaster for Boy Scout Troop 20. He enjoyed working with youth of Upson County as he served on many committees for the Recreation Department. Mr. Morgan worked as a Supervisor for Martha Mills and was a member of Jeff Davis Baptist Church.

He is survived by his wife, Mrs. Irene Dickerson Morgan, of Thomaston, Ga.; son, William Franklin “Bill” Morgan of Thomaston, Ga.; daughter, Wanda Ruth (David) King of Port Orchard, Wash.; daughter, Julia Eve (Jody) Calloway, Metter, Ga.; son, Robert Levi “Bob” Morgan, of Thomaston, Ga.; siblings, Janice Morgan (Gene) Englett, Douglasville, Ga.; Walter Gene Morgan, Danielsville, Ga.; Billy Royce Morgan, Forsyth, Ga.; Joyce Morgan Tucker, Manchester, Ga.; Marie Morgan (Winston) Saucer, Manchester, Ga.; five grandchildren, Seth Morgan, of Thomaston, Ga.; Andrew King, of Port Orchard, Wash.; Rob Morgan, of Thomaston, Ga; Morgan and Lindsay Calloway, of Metter, Ga.; and 12 great-grandchildren also survive. Memorial donations may be made to Jeff Davis Baptist Church.
